Main Duties & Responsibilities
You will join an established team of Civil Engineers, supporting multidisciplinary design schemes and assisting with the delivery of projects within the Water sector. You will also provide support to a group of motivated, developing Engineers and Technicians.
Projects vary in size and complexity and may involve optioneering, outline design, or detailed design. Work may be directly for water companies or via a contractor under a design and construct contract.
